(09-12-2020, 08:25 AM)Michael Laws Wrote:  The AMS2 netcode is still dodgy. In the last series, I compared replays with Juan Reinoso after a contact. From each point of view the incident was quite different.
The incident reporting in AMS2 is still really dodgy too, and worst of all it's still a mystery as when they will trigger.
Crew chief is really helpful. There is a setting that delays how long after the start it starts spotting around you. You want to reduce this to get spotting right from the start.

Unfortunately for me this was the straw that broke the camel's back. Everyone has priorities for what they want from a sim and mine is competitive multiplayer. It's clear that AMS2 + SRS is not the right combo for me at the moment. The game is unstable and one game crash has meant I have zero chance of winning the championship even if I win the last race to make it 5/6. The points structure in SRS is designed for packed multi split servers. If this was AC I could just run in another session and have the result register towards the championship. But that's not an option here and I rarely get anyone to race in the Ginetta series so I'm excluded from that championship too.

On Friday I signed up for iRacing and the appeal of a multitude of races throughout the day is great for my needs. The game just feels so 'sorted' compared to the still wet behind the ears AMS2. I'm not used to the sim yet so it still feels a bit foreign but in time that will change. The only downside is the hit to my wallet.
